Henfield's Royal Celebrations

Picture
In memory of Queen Elizabeth II: 1926 - 2022

Henfield has a long tradition of marking royal occasions in style and often in costume. To mark the Platinum Jubilee celebrations of Queen Elizabeth II in June 2022, we share here a selection of photos from jubilees and coronations past. Plus, a selection from the most recent event which will be accessioned into the museum collection.

The Platinum Jubilee, 2022

The Children's Jubilee Fun Day, Thursday 2nd June
Held on the Kingsfield, events included a tug of war, field sports, crown making and of course a bouncy castle, all under a sky of dramatic cumulus clouds.
The Giant Family Jubilee Picnic and Fancy Dress Competition, Sunday 5th June
Held on Henfield Common, here we see the children's line-up with a mixture of kings and queens, patriotic fare, a suited gent, superheroes and Mario and Luigi! Our Costume Curator awards the commemorative medals (and sweets) and we see the formal opening by the Vicar, his dog and the Parish Council Chair, marooned in a lush field of green, while the Patcham Silver Band prepare for an outing of 'Sussex by the Sea'.
